Why is an electrical inspection especially important for my Honolulu home?

Honolulu's coastal environment exposes wiring to salt air, which accelerates corrosion and can lead to faulty connections, short circuits, or even fire hazards. Additionally, local rodent populations often chew through wiring insulation. A professional inspection by J&H Electric proactively identifies these specific, localized problems before they cause a major failure or safety issue, giving you peace of mind.

What does J&H Electric look for during an inspection regarding rodent damage?

Our electricians thoroughly examine attics, crawl spaces, and behind walls for signs of gnawed wire insulation, nesting materials near electrical boxes, and droppings. We check for exposed conductors that can arc and overheat. If we find damage, we'll recommend safe repairs or rewiring of the affected circuits to restore safety and prevent future infestations from causing the same problem.

Can an inspection prevent problems from salt air corrosion on my wiring?

Absolutely. While we can't stop the corrosion process, our inspection identifies its early stages—such as greenish buildup on connections (verdigris) or brittle, discolored insulation. We then recommend protective measures like applying anti-corrosion compounds, upgrading to corrosion-resistant fixtures and connections rated for marine environments, and creating a maintenance schedule to monitor and address issues proactively.
